"Extra" is an English word that is used as an adjective to mean "additional" or "beyond what is expected or required." It is often used to describe something that is more than the usual amount or beyond what is necessary.
The word "extra" comes from the Latin word "extra," which means "outside" or "beyond." It was originally used in English to describe something that was beyond the usual or expected, and it has been used in this way for many centuries.
Here are a few examples of how "extra" is used in English:
"Can I have extra cheese on my pizza?" (请问我的披萨可以加多一点奶酪吗?)
"I'll need an extra blanket to keep warm tonight." (今晚需要再加一条毯子保暖。)
"The movie was an extra hour longer than I expected." (这部电影比我预期的要长一小时。)
"I'm going to have to work extra hours this week to meet the deadline." (这周我要加班来达到最后期限。)
